The Constitutional Prosecutor in Pristina has filed a request for the appointment of the detention measure against the defendant, which has deceived the injured, as if to provide terms for working visas abroad, to the competent court”, the statement said.
Meanwhile, Kosovo Police have called on citizens who may have been deceived about terms for working visas abroad to be notified at the nearest police station.
“Supported the first results of the investigation, police have raised the suspicion that fraud may have occurred consistently over a long period of time, and that the number of persons deceived by suspected persons may be greater than the reported number”.
Therefore, we ask citizens who may have been the victim of such cases to be notified at the nearest police station to help police towards the final probe”, police reports.
